Title VII

A section of the Civil Rights Act of 1964 that prohibits employment discrimination based on race, color, religion, sex, or national origin.

Disparate-Impact

Disparate impact occurs when policies, practices, rules, or other systems that appear to be neutral result in a disproportionate impact on a protected group.

Employment Discrimination

The unfair treatment of employees or job applicants based on race, gender, age, religion, national origin, disability, or other protected characteristics.
